I want to sell it but for what? Was $899. It's handmade by a luthier.
SPECS:
One piece mahogany body, hard maple neck, 12"R rosewood fretboard, 1 11/16" nut, 24 frets, Sperzel locking tunners, graphtech saddles (nut?), double action truss rod, quality hardware, Schaller strap locks.
